Why Does Camping Near Water Improve Your Experience?

Camping near water offers a range of benefits that can transform a simple camping trip into an unforgettable experience. Here are some reasons why being close to water is advantageous:

  • Scenic Views: Water bodies often provide stunning landscapes, enhancing the visual appeal of your campsite.
  • Recreational Activities: Water offers opportunities for swimming, fishing, kayaking, and boating.
  • Relaxation and Tranquility: The sound of water can create a soothing background, aiding relaxation and sleep.
  • Wildlife Watching: Water attracts a variety of wildlife, offering unique opportunities to observe animals in their natural habitat.

What Activities Can You Enjoy When Camping Near Water?

Camping near water opens up a plethora of activities that cater to different interests and age groups. Here are some popular activities:

  1. Swimming: Enjoy a refreshing dip in a nearby lake or river.
  2. Fishing: Try your hand at catching local fish species.
  3. Kayaking or Canoeing: Explore the water with a kayak or canoe.
  4. Boating: Rent a boat for a leisurely ride or an adventurous sail.
  5. Wildlife Observation: Spot birds, fish, and other wildlife that thrive around water bodies.

What Are the Safety Considerations for Camping Near Water?

While camping near water is enjoyable, it comes with specific safety considerations:

  • Water Safety: Always supervise children and inexperienced swimmers.
  • Weather Awareness: Check weather forecasts to avoid unexpected storms or floods.
  • Wildlife Precautions: Be mindful of wildlife that may be attracted to water areas.

What Should I Pack for a Camping Trip Near Water?

When camping near water, pack essentials like swimwear, fishing gear, water shoes, and waterproof bags. Consider bringing a life jacket if you plan on engaging in water sports.

How Can I Ensure a Sustainable Camping Experience by Water?

To ensure a sustainable camping experience, follow Leave No Trace principles. Dispose of waste properly, respect wildlife, and avoid using harmful chemicals near water sources.
